The aircraft carrier USS Nimitz prepares to set anchor in Sasebo Bay for a port visit. Nimitz is operating as part of the U.S. 7th Fleet operating in the Western Pacific and Indian Oceans. The 7th Fleet is the largest of the forward-deployed fleets with approximately 50 ships, 120 aircraft and 20,000 Sailors and Marines.
